The Evolution of Online Slot Machines
The online slot machine landscape has transformed dramatically since their inception, evolving from simple mechanical devices to sophisticated digital experiences. Initially, slot machines were mechanical marvels, featuring physical reels and buttons that players would pull to set the game in motion. These early slots, often found in land-based casinos, were simple affairs, with limited symbols and paylines.
As technology advanced, so did the slot machines. The introduction of electronic slot machines in the 1970s marked a significant leap forward. These new machines used digital processors instead of mechanical reels, allowing for more complex game designs and the ability to offer multiple paylines. The introduction of the Random Number Generator (RNG) in the 1980s brought a new level of fairness to the games, ensuring that each spin was unpredictable and unbiased.
The rise of the internet in the 1990s paved the way for online slot machines. Initially, these digital versions of the classic slots were fairly straightforward, mimicking the look and feel of their land-based counterparts. However, as web technology improved, so too did the online slot offerings. Flash-based games became popular, offering a more interactive and visually appealing experience for players.
The early 2000s saw the introduction of HTML5, which allowed for the creation of mobile-friendly slots. This was a game-changer, as it meant that players could enjoy their favorite slots on the go, using their smartphones and tablets. The graphics and gameplay were optimized for smaller screens, ensuring a seamless experience regardless of the device.
Around the same time, software developers began to push the boundaries of slot machine design. They started incorporating bonus rounds, special symbols, and progressive jackpots, which added layers of excitement and complexity to the games. These features, combined with improved graphics and sound design, made online slots more engaging than ever before.

How Slot Machine Simulators Work
Slot machine simulators have come a long way since their inception, offering a blend of nostalgia and cutting-edge technology. These digital replicas of the classic one-armed bandits have become a staple in the online gambling world, captivating players with their vibrant graphics and engaging gameplay. Understanding how these simulators work can enhance your experience and help you navigate the vast array of options available.
The core of a slot machine simulator is a random number generator (RNG), which is the heart of its operation. Unlike the mechanical slot machines of yesteryears, which relied on physical reels and levers, modern simulators use sophisticated software to determine the outcome of each spin. Here’s a breakdown of the key components and processes involved:
-
User Interface: The first thing you’ll notice when you open a slot machine simulator is the user interface. It typically includes a display area where the reels are shown, buttons to start the game, and various settings and options. The interface is designed to mimic the look and feel of a real slot machine, with buttons that light up and sounds that enhance the experience.
-
Reel Symbols: The reels in a slot machine simulator are filled with various symbols, which can range from classic fruit and bar icons to more complex and thematic designs. These symbols are what determine the potential payouts and bonus rounds within the game.
-
Random Number Generator (RNG): The RNG is the most critical component of a slot machine simulator. It ensures that each spin is completely random, making it impossible to predict the outcome. The RNG generates numbers at a rate of thousands per second, and when you hit the spin button, it selects a number at that exact moment to determine the symbols that will land on the reels.
-
Paylines and Payouts: Slot machines can have a variety of paylines, which are the lines that determine where winning combinations must appear. When matching symbols align along a payline, the player is awarded a payout based on the game’s paytable. The RNG also determines the outcome of bonus rounds, which can offer additional chances to win big.
